B
Imagine you're playing video games with some friends and they speak of your
favourite game. “Oh, that game is easy. There is no need to waste time on it,”
someone says. The others agree. Though you enjoy the game very much, you choose
to agree with them instead of being different.
You have just experienced peer(同伴) pressure. You will follow what your
peers do or think so that they will accept you. Teenagers usually spend more time
with their friends, and they may have experienced the influence of peers in many
situations.
According to Dr Casey, teenagers are often accurate(准确的) in making
decisions on their own. However, when they make decisions too quickly or with
peers around, their decisions often have something to do with their peers. In a study
about peer pressure, some teenagers played a video driving game, either alone or
with friends watching. The result showed that teenagers took double risks when their
friends were watching, compared with when they played alone.
Just as some people can influence us to make injudicious choices, they can also
influence us to make good ones. Teenagers might take part in a volunteer activity
because their friends are doing it, or try to work hard to get good grades because
their friends are doing well in studying. In fact, friends are often good examples for
each other.
While we are always under the influence of others, to follow or not is up to us.

六、读写综合(本大题分为 A、B两部分, 共 25分)
A. 回答问题(本题共 5小题, 每小题 2分, 共 10分)
Emotions play a big role in our health. When we feel happy and relaxed, our body works
better. But when we are stressed or angry, it can harm our health.
Positive emotions like joy and laughter help us stay strong. They make the immune system(
免疫系统 )work well, so we get sick less often. For example, people who laugh a lot usually
have lower stress levels and better heart health. Also, being happy helps us sleep better, which is
6
important for energy and focus.
However, negative emotions like anger, sadness or fear can cause health problems. Too
much stress can lead to headaches, stomachaches, or even high blood pressure. Some studies
show that long-term stress weakens the immune system, making people catch colds or other
illnesses more easily.
To stay healthy, we should manage our emotions well. Here are some tips:
● Exercise—It helps reduce stress and makes us happier.
● Talk to our friends or family—Sharing feelings can lighten sadness.
● Practise deep breathing—It calms the mind when feeling angry.
In conclusion, emotions have a powerful effect on our bodies. By staying positive and
managing stress, we can keep both our minds and bodies healthy.
